Fitment Breakdown: Enkei PF05 on the Hyundai Veloster N Base 2020
I walked around this Veloster N at the show and the fitment immediately caught my eye. The 18x8.5 Enkei PF05 setup looks perfect on the stock suspension. Those +38 offsets push the wheels right to the edge of the fender line.
The Veloster N platform is notoriously picky about wheel fitment. These Enkei wheels clear the massive front calipers with room to spare. You do not need any spacers to make these fit correctly.
The hub bore matches up nicely without needing annoying rings. We love how the 18-inch diameter keeps the rotating mass low. It helps the car stay nimble in the corners.
The spoke design on the PF05 gives the wheel a deep, aggressive look. Even with the stock dampers, the wheels look tucked just enough to avoid rubbing issues. You get a clean, flush appearance without hacking up your fenders.
The barrel depth on these wheels provides a nice visual weight. It balances the quirky, asymmetrical body lines of the Veloster N. I checked the clearance under full lock, and you have plenty of room.
You might see slight poke if you switch to a wide, square-shouldered track tire. For a daily driver, this setup is about as flush as it gets. It is a textbook example of how to upgrade your stance.
What We Recommend for Hyundai Veloster N Base 2020 Owners
If you want to replicate this look, stick to the 18x8.5 sizing. Going wider will force you to run aggressive camber plates to avoid rub. Keep the offset between +35 and +45 for the best results.
We always suggest a square setup for the Veloster N. It keeps the handling balanced and allows for tire rotations. Staggered setups on this front-wheel-drive platform just ruin the factory turn-in feel.
Watch out for tire selection when you buy your rubber. A 235 or 245 width tire is the sweet spot for these rims. Anything wider starts to look like a bubble and ruins the clean lines of the PF05.
Avoid the temptation to go for a massive offset just to get poke. You will sacrifice your wheel bearings and destroy your paint with rock chips. A +38 offset is the golden ratio for this car.
Common mistakes usually involve buying cheap, heavy wheels that ruin the N's suspension geometry. Stick to flow-formed wheels like these Enkeis to save unsprung weight. Your dampers will thank you, and the car will handle like it should.

Full Specs Breakdown
Here is exactly what this owner is running. We break down every detail so you can replicate this build or use it as a starting point for your own setup.
- Car Make & Model: Hyundai Veloster N Base 2020
- Vehicle Color:
- Wheel Brand & Model: Enkei PF05
- Wheel Size: 18×8.5 / 18×8.5
- Offset: 38 / 38
- Wheel Finish: Gunmetal
- Tires: General G-MAX RS 245/40 25.7″x9.6″ / 245/40 25.7″x9.6″
- Suspension: Stock
